// Constants for Fixtureforge, our test-data factory library.
// Reviewer notes: generated records are deterministic per seed, so
// changing any constant below invalidates recorded snapshots and
// forces a regeneration pass across dependent suites. Collection
// sizes are intentionally small to keep CI under budget; the large
// variants live behind the stress profile. Keep referential depth
// capped or the graph builder recurses badly on cyclic schemas.
// The current defaults, used by every factory unless overridden, are:

constants for hahig-hahag:
TIERS = {
    "gorwyn": 183,
    "gorir": 689,
    "wenir": 585,
    "fraiel": 643,
    "sordor": 38,
    "fenmir": 251,
    "jorax": 1020,
}

**Ticket: Expired credential blocking template-render benchmarks**

The nightly performance suite for the Quillet template renderer has failed three runs in a row. Root cause: the credential used to pull fixture bundles from the internal assets service in the Farrowgate cluster expired on the 14th, so benchmarks abort before warm-up and we have no regression data for the pending release. Please do not promote the candidate build until a clean run completes. A replacement credential has been issued and appears below.

service key, bajep-hahig: zpat15_8GdlyV2kd9BCqYH

## Runbook: Tidewire Websocket Reconnect Loop

Some Tidewire desktop clients enter a reconnect loop when the Brackenholt gateway rotates nodes mid-session. Symptoms: customer reports "connecting..." spinner repeating every 5 seconds. Confirm by checking the client's session log for repeated code 1006 closures. Workaround: ask the customer to sign out fully and relaunch. If the loop persists, force-expire their session via the Oxmere admin console, which authenticates with the key below.

gateway credential: kto23_LX9A4ys6i4nzHtpOLNLodKK

# Break-glass: Flipcoin Assignment Service

Quick note for the sync: if Flipcoin (our A/B assignment service) starts handing out bad bucket splits and the config UI is down, you can break glass. Ping whoever's on call first — sessions get audited. The emergency account skips SSO entirely, so the usual login won't work. You'll need the recovery passphrase instead, which lives right below.

unlock words, yawig-kagef: gordor-holvan-ulaael-pramir-ulaiel-tamdor